Output ef203a08a153523f8ca2a8f3ea0f2197ec19e6de13f61bb934c997890db830ba:0

value
20596867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d297ae39a523e3515930ae17fdcd7ac702220be OP_EQUALVERIFY OP_CHECKSIG
address
1FKznCeNd7Q5kH76eNDWiQ6FX1XY7ALBue
transaction
ef203a08a153523f8ca2a8f3ea0f2197ec19e6de13f61bb934c997890db830ba
spent
true